模組觀念 - Linux

Table of Contents

我trace核心編譯過程,在生成 vmlinux.o ,我看到主要構成內容為 built-in.o

而 built-in.o 就是對應各個目錄下的 Makefile裡面的 obj-y 模組,所以我想問

那obj-$(CONFIG_XXX_XXX) 這種的就是屬於 external modules 囉? 而 built-in.o

為內部模組?

--

All Comments

Olivia avatarOlivia2014-01-28
CONFIG_XXX_XXX=y 則 obj-$(CONFIG_XXX_XXX) ==> obj-y
Edward Lewis avatarEdward Lewis2014-02-01
CONFIG_XXX_XXX=m 則 obj-$(CONFIG_XXX_XXX) ==> obj-m